Spelling suggestions: "subject:"argumenta rebate"" "subject:"argumenta rebatida""
1 |
Toma de decisiones usando argumentación rebatibleFerretti, Edgardo 14 April 2009 (has links)
La argumentacion es un modelo de razonamiento basado
e la construcción y evaluación de argumentos que interactúan entre sí. Estos argumentos tienen como fin, soportar,
explcar o atacar enunciados que pueden ser opiniones, decisiones, etc. La argumentación ha sido utilzada en diferentes dominios, como razonamiento no monótono, manejo de inconsistencias en bases de conocimiento y modelado de diferentes tipos de diálgos en particular, persuasión y negociación. Un enfoque de negociación basado en argumentación tiene la venta a de que además de intercambiar ofertas, se intercambian razones que las soportan y que eventualmente podrán llevar al receptor a
cambiar sus preferencias. En consecuencia, se puede llegar a un acuerdo entre ls partes de manera más conveniente.
De esta manera, adoptar un enfoque de este estilo en los problemas de decisión, tendría el beneficio de que el tomador de decisiones además de tener una buena el elección, tendría las razones subyacentes que la soportan de una manera
fácil de entender. La toma de decisiones basada en argumentación, es más afín al a forma en que los seres humanos deliberan y finalente toman o entienden una
elección.
La idea de articular decisiones en base a argumentos es relevante para varios enfoques diferentes de decisión,
tales como decisión bajo incertidumbre, decisión multi-criterio y decisiones basadas en reglas. En general puede decirse que los diversos enfoques propuestos construyen para cada decisión posible un conjunto de argumentos a su favor y
un conjunto de argumentos en su contra. No obstante, los tomadores de decisiones no se limitan solamente a construir estos conjuntos, sino que ellos intercambian argumentos, los
hacen interactuar, atacándose o defendiéndose entre ellos. Asimismo, dentro de un enfoque particular de decisión, existen propuestas muy diversas que difieren en: los lenguajes de
representación de conocimiento y razonamiento que
utilizan, si su definición está dada dentro de una arquitectura de agente particular, la formalidad con l que se relacionan
con enfoques clásicos de toma de decisiones, etc.
En particular, en esta Tesis, se presenta un framework
original de toma de decisiones individual es que está vinculado formalmente con la Teoría de Decisión Clásica, pero
justificado desde el punto de vista de la argumentación.
El framework propuesto paral a toma de decisiones basadas en argumentación, combina el uso de argumentos y reglas de decisión.
El criterio de comparación de argumentos utilzado, se basa en prioridades entre literales que representan las
preferencias del agente (tomador de decisiones). Estos literales forman parte del programa del agente, y al realizar
cambios en las relaciones de preferencia entre los mismos, se puede cambiar de manera flexible las preferencias del agente
y el criterio de preferencia entre argumentos.
Nuestro enfoque también incluye una metodolgía simple para
desarrollar las componentes de decisión del agente. De esta manera, un framework de decisión desarrollado siguiendo esta metodolgía exhibe propiedades interesantes, con respecto
a la coherencia que muestra el agente en la toma de decisiones.
Si el agente, tiene disponible todo el conocimiento relvante acerca de sus preferencias con respecto a todas las
posibles alternativas que se l podrán presentar, entonces
el comportamiento de el eccion correspondiente
al framework propuesto, coincide con el comportamiento optimo respecto de una relación de preferencia racional. En cambio, si el agente tiene conocimiento parcial acerca de sus preferencias, las
decisiones que este tomará también exhibirán un cierto grado de coherencia. En particular en este caso, nuestro enfoque implmenta una estructura de elcción que satisface el axioma
débil de la preferencia revelada. Los principios enunciados en esta Tesis, serán ejemplificados en dos dominios de
aplicación distintos. En el primero, se analiza cómo se
desarrollan los procesos de decisión de un robot que
realiza tareas de limpieza y debe decidir qué caja transportará a continuación. Se presentan ejemplos donde el robot posee información completa e incompleta acerca de sus preferencias de elección, consiste de un agente de software
de impresión que debe decidir a qué impresora de la red manda un cierto trabajo, en función de las características
de las impresoras y de su disponibilidad. En este dominio
particular, también se presentan ejemplos con información
completa sobre las preferencias del agente y se muestra cómo desarrollarlos componentes de decisión para la
aplicación del framework.
|
2 |
Planificación y formalización de acciones para agentes inteligentesGarcía, Diego R. 16 April 2012 (has links)
En esta tesis se define un formalismo que combina acciones y argumentación rebatible para representar dominios y proble-mas de planificación. Lo novedoso de este formalismo es que permite representar conocimiento acerca del dominio y definir acciones utilizando la Programación en Lógica Rebatible. El conocimiento del dominio permite razonar rebatiblemente
acerca de las precondiciones, restricciones y efectos de las acciones, las cuales permiten cambiar el entorno para lograr las metas de un problema de planificación. Además, se define un nuevo método de planificación que combina técnicas de Planificación de Orden Parcial con Argumentación Rebatible, y permite resolver problemas de planificación definidos utilizando el formalismo de representación antes mencionado. La incor-poración de Argumentación Rebatible permite utilizar el cono-cimiento del dominio para razonar rebatiblemente durante la construcción de un plan. Los formalismos basados en argumen-tación rebatible permiten representar y razonar con conoci-miento que involucre información incompleta o errónea. Esta característica está presente en muchos aspectos de un pro-ceso de planificación, donde no siempre es posible contar de ante mano con toda la informacion necesaria para resolver un problema.
|
3 |
Formalización y generalización del manejo de preferencias en servicios de razonamiento rebatibleTeze, Juan Carlos Lionel 30 March 2017 (has links)
Esta tesis aborda el estudio, diseño y formalización de herramientas computacionales
concretas para seleccionar y cambiar el criterio de preferencia entre argumentos que es
utilizado por el sistema de Programación Lógica Rebatible (DeLP) requerido para decidir
derrotas al analizar ataques entre argumentos. Para lograr esto, se proponen varios servicios
de razonamiento basados en DeLP que disponen de distintos criterios y permiten
llevar a cabo esta tarea de diferentes maneras. Como parte de la contribución, se propone
un servicio que utiliza expresiones condicionales para programar cómo seleccionar el
criterio que mejor se ajusta a las preferencias del usuario o a una situación en particular.
Por otra parte, en la tesis se aborda también la definición de un servicio con mecanismos
que permiten no solo seleccionar sino también combinar criterios. Estos mecanismos permiten
que sea posible comparar argumentos considerando de manera simultánea más de
un criterio.
Como se detalla a continuación, DeLP ha demostrado ser de gran utilidad en diferentes
dominios de aplicación [CCS05, RGS07, GCS08, GGS10]. Los formalismos propuestos
incorporan herramientas concretas para tratar el manejo de múltiples criterios de preferencia
entre argumentos, lo cual no ha sido considerado hasta el momento por otros
trabajos. En consecuencia, los resultados obtenidos en esta tesis brindan una contribución importante a los desarrollos en la comunidad de argumentación, particularmente en
el campo de los sistemas basados en Programación Lógica Rebatible, significando además
un aporte dentro del área de Inteligencia Artifcial en las Ciencias de la Computación.
|
4 |
Integración de argumentación rebatible y ontologías en el contexto de la web semántica : formalización y aplicacionesGómez, Sergio Alejandro 25 June 2009 (has links)
La World Wide Web actual está compuesta principalmente por documentos escritos para su presentación visual para usuarios humanos. Sin embargo, para obtener todo el
potencial de la web es necesario que los programas de computadoras o agentes sean capaces de comprender la información presente en la web. En este sentido, la Web Semántica es una visión futura de la web donde la información tiene significado exacto, permitiendo así que las computadoras entiendan y razonen en base a la información hallada en la web. La Web Semántica propone resolver el problema de la asignación de semántica a los recursos web por medio de metadatos cuyo significado es dado a través de definiciones de ontologías, que son formalizaciones del conocimiento de un dominio de aplicación. El estándar del World Wide Web Consortium propone que las ontologías sean definidas en el lenguaje OWL, el cual se halla basado en las Lógicas para la Descripción. A pesar de que las definiciones de ontologías expresadas en Lógicas para la Descripción pueden
ser procesadas por razonadores estándar, tales razonadores son incapaces de lidiar con ontologías inconsistentes.
Los sistemas argumentativos constituyen una formalización del razonamiento rebatible donde se pone especial enfasis en la noción de argumento. Así, la construcción de argumentos
permite que un agente obtenga conclusiones en presencia de información incompleta y potencialmente contradictoria. En particular, la Programación en Lógica Rebatible es un formalismo basado en la argumentación rebatible y la Programación en Lógica. En esta Disertación, la importancia de la definición de ontologías para poder llevar a cabo la realización de la iniciativa de la Web Semántica junto con la presencia de ontologías incompletas y potencialmente contradictorias motivó el desarrollo de un marco de razonamiento con las llamadas -ontologías. Investigaciones previas de otros autores, determinaron que un subconjunto de las Lógicas para la Descripción pueden ser traducidas
efectivamente a un conjunto de la Programación en Lógica. Nuestra propuesta involucra asignar semántica a ontologías expresadas en Lógicas para la Descripción por medio de
Programas Lógicos Rebatibles para lidiar con definiciones de ontologías inconsistentes en la Web Semántica. Esto es, dada una ontología OWL expresada en el lenguaje OWLDL,
es posible construir una ontología DL equivalente expresada en las Lógicas para la Descripción. En el caso en que DL satisfaga ciertas restricciones, esta puede ser expresada
como un programa DeLP P. Por lo tanto, dada una consulta acerca de la pertenencia de una instancia a a un cierto concepto C expresada con respecto a OWL, se realiza un
análisis dialectico con respecto a P para determinar todas las razones a favor y en contra de la plausibilidad de la afirmación C(a). Por otro lado, la integración de datos es el problema de combinar datos residiendo en diferentes fuentes y el de proveer al usuario con una vista unificada de dichos datos. El problema de diseñar sistemas de integración de datos es particularmente importante en el contexto de aplicaciones en la Web Semántica donde las ontologías son desarrolladas independientemente unas de otras, y por esta razón pueden ser mutuamente inconsistentes.
Dada una ontología, nos interesa conocer en que condiciones un individuo es una instancia de un cierto concepto. Como cuando se tienen varias ontologías, los mismos conceptos pueden tener nombres distintos para un mismo significado o aún nombres iguales para significados diferentes, para relacionar los conceptos entre dos ontologías diferentes se utilizaron reglas puente o de articulación. De esta manera, un concepto se corresponde a una vista sobre otros conceptos de otra ontología. Mostramos también bajo que condiciones la propuesta del razonamiento con -ontologías puede ser adaptada a los dos tipos de integración de ontologías global-as-view y local-as-view considerados en la literatura especializada. Además, analizamos las propiedades formales que se desprenden de este acercamiento
novedoso al tratamiento de ontologías inconsistentes en la Web Semántica. Los principales resultados obtenidos son que, como la interpretación de -ontologías como Programas
Lógicos Rebatibles es realizada a través de una función de transformación que preserva la semántica de las ontologías involucradas, los resultados obtenidos al realizar consultas
son sensatos. También, mostramos que el operador presentado es además consistente y significativo. El acercamiento al razonamiento en presencia de ontologías inconsistentes brinda la posibilidad de abordar de una manera ecaz ciertos problemas de aplicacion del ámbito del comercio electrónico, donde el modelo de reglas de negocio puede ser especificado en términos de ontologías. Entonces, la capacidad de razonar frente a ontologías inconsistentes
permite abordajes alternativos conceptualmente más claros, ya que es posible automatizar ciertas decisiones de negocios tomadas a la luz de un conjunto de reglas de negocio posiblemente inconsistentes expresadas como una o varias ontologías y tener un sistema capaz de brindar una explicación del porque se arribo a una conclusión determinada.
En consecuencia, presentamos entonces una aplicación del razonamiento sobre ontologías inconsistentes por medio de la argumentación rebatible al modelado de formularios
en la World Wide Web. La noción de los formularios como una manera de organizar y presentar datos ha sido utilizada desde el comienzo de la World Wide Web. Los formularios
Web han evolucionado junto con el desarrollo de nuevos lenguajes de marcado, en los cuales es posible proveer guiones de validación como parte del código del formulario
para verificar que el signifiado pretendido del formulario es correcto. Sin embargo, para el diseñador del formulario, parte de este significado pretendido frecuentemente involucra
otras características que no son restricciones por sí mismas, sino más bien atributos emergentes del formulario, los cuales brindan conclusiones plausibles en el contexto de
información incompleta y potencialmente contradictoria. Como el valor de tales atributos puede cambiar en presencia de nuevo conocimiento, los llamamos atributos rebatibles.
Propusimos entonces extender los formularios web para incorporar atributos rebatibles como parte del conocimiento que puede ser codifiado por el diseñador del formulario, por
medio de los llamados -formularios; dicho conocimiento puede ser especificado mediante un programa DeLP, y posteriormente, como una ontología expresada en Lógicas para la Descripción.
|
Page generated in 0.0972 seconds